What is a Virtual BCBA job?

A Virtual BCBA (Board Certified Behavior Analyst) job involves providing remote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) services to clients, typically children with autism or other developmental disabilities. Virtual BCBAs conduct assessments, create behavioral intervention plans, provide caregiver training, and supervise behavior technicians through telehealth platforms. This role requires strong communication skills, technological proficiency, and adherence to ethical guidelines to ensure effective remote support.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Virtual Bcba position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Virtual BCBA, you must have a master's degree in behavior analysis or a related field, active BCBA certification, and expertise in developing and supervising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) programs. Familiarity with telehealth platforms, electronic data collection systems, and HIPAA compliance is essential. Strong communication, time management, and problem-solving skills set top performers apart when supporting clients, families, and remote teams. These skills ensure effective assessment, intervention, and collaboration in a virtual environment while maintaining client privacy and high standards of care.

What are the typical challenges faced by a Virtual BCBA, and how can they be addressed?

Virtual BCBAs often encounter challenges such as establishing rapport with clients remotely, ensuring parent or caregiver engagement during sessions, and troubleshooting technical issues during telehealth appointments. Overcoming these obstacles requires creative engagement strategies, regular communication with families, and proficiency with telehealth tools to facilitate seamless sessions. Most organizations provide training and technical support to help BCBAs adjust to remote service delivery. Successful Virtual BCBAs maintain flexibility, adaptability, and a proactive approach to overcoming the unique challenges of the virtual care environment.
